Frequently Asked Questions

What battery capacities do you offer for Nissan Leaf models?

CNS offers 40kWh, 50kWh, 62kWh, and 68kWh options for all Leaf models (ZE0, AZE0, ZE1). The 62kWh option is the most popular for eco-commuters seeking maximum range without compromising vehicle compatibility.

How long does installation take?

Most installations take 1-2 hours with a professional technician. DIY installations typically take 2-3 hours following our detailed video tutorials. We provide step-by-step video guides, installation manuals, and even remote video support to ensure a smooth process.

Are CNS batteries compatible with my specific Nissan Leaf model?

Yes, but we recommend confirming compatibility through our free VIN check. Simply provide your vehicle’s year, model, and VIN, and our experts will verify perfect compatibility before you place your order.

What’s the difference between Pack and Module options?

Battery “Packs” are complete replacement units that install as a single unit. “Modules” are individual battery components that require more technical expertise to replace. For most eco-commuters, the Pack option is the easiest and most reliable choice.
